AI Contract Overview
The contract requires NICET IV-level engineering oversight for Fire Detection Systems to ensure full compliance with NFPA 72, DA Pam 190-51, and seamless integration with existing security infrastructure. The scope demands expert technical supervision to verify system design, installation, testing, and maintenance align with federal fire safety standards and Department of Defense protocols, with primary performance occurring in White Hall, Arkansas, ZIP 71602. All work must be executed by qualified professionals holding the highest level of NICET certification in fire alarm systems. The solicitation, classified as a subcontract under NAICS code 541330, is issued by the Department of Defense under the agency identifier W6QK Acc-Ri and was posted on July 31, 2026, with a response deadline of August 10, 2026, at 3:00 PM. Proposals must demonstrate proven experience in military facility fire protection systems and the ability to interface fire detection technology with broader security networks. There is no set-aside designation specified, and all submissions must be submitted through the provided SAM.gov portal prior to the stated deadline.
